This information is taken from the statutory List as it was in 2001 and may not be up to date.

FINEDON SIDEGATE LANE SP976W (East side) 2/44 Carrol Spring Farmhouse 26/10/76 - II Farmhouse. c.1836 for Reverend Samuel Woodfield Paul, Vicar of Finedon. Regular coursed limestone with slate roof. Double-depth plan. 3 storeys. 2-window range.

Central C20 door under flat arch head with keyblock. Casement windows under flat arch heads with keyblocks. Hipped roof with brick stacks at ends. Datestone between second floor windows has Reverend Pauls initials. Interior not inspected. Allocated to the Vicar of Finedon by the Enclosure Act of 1806.
